Atracurium besylate
Based on 1 publication(s) in Google Scholar
Atracurium (BW-33A) besylate is a potent, competitive and non-depolarizing neuromuscular blocking agent. Atracurium besylate also is an AChR receptor antagonist. Atracurium besylate induces bronchoconstriction and neuromuscular blockade. Atracurium besylate promotes astroglial differentiation.

Biological Activity
Atracurium besylate (10 μM; 72 h) promotes astroglial but not neuronal differentiation in HSR040622 and HSR040821 cells[4].
Atracurium besylate (10 μM; 48 h) reduces tumor engraftment and increases survival of mice xenotransplanted with ex-vivo treated GSCs[4].
Atracurium besylate (2.4 μM; 120 min) induces a complete fade of the tetanic contraction while only slightly affected the twitch in rat extensor digitorum longus muscle cells[5].
